Plumbing emergencies

A true plumbing emergency is water you cannot stop, sewage coming back into the house, or no water at all. In all three cases, shut off the main water valve first, then call. Emergency plumbers average around $170 per hour in 2026, and most emergency calls total $100–$500. Anything that can safely wait until morning will cost you meaningfully less in daylight.

The first action in almost every plumbing emergency is the same: close the main shutoff. It's usually where the supply line enters the house, near the water heater, in a basement or crawlspace, or at a curb box near the street. If you have not located and tested yours, do it today — not while standing in water.

For a water heater emergency, shut the cold inlet valve on top of the tank and cut the power or gas to the unit before anything else. For a sewage backup, stop using every fixture in the house immediately, including toilets and the washing machine; every gallon you send down makes the backup worse.

Emergency pricing is real and mostly legitimate — you're paying for a tech to leave their house at midnight. What isn't legitimate is using that moment to sell you a whole-home project. Authorize the stabilization work only. Put in writing that you're approving the emergency repair and nothing else, then get competitive bids on the larger fix once the water has stopped.

Document everything while it's happening. Photos and video of standing water, the source, and the damage, plus the timestamped invoice, are what an insurance adjuster will ask for. Water damage and freezing is one of the most common homeowners claims — the Insurance Information Institute puts it at around one in 60 insured homes per year, averaging roughly $13,954 per claim over 2018–2022.

How to choose

Find and test your main shutoff now
Turn it fully off and back on once a year. Old valves seize. Discovering that during a burst pipe is the worst possible time.
Stop using water during a sewage backup
Every flush and every load of laundry pushes more sewage into the house. This is the single most useful thing you can do before the truck arrives.
Authorize stabilization only
Write "approved: emergency stabilization only" on the work authorization. It's your strongest protection against a midnight upsell.
Photograph before cleanup
Adjusters need to see the damage in place. Take wide shots and close shots, and keep every receipt including for fans, towels, and hotel nights.
Call your insurer early, before you commit to restoration
Many carriers have preferred restoration networks and notice requirements. Calling first can change what's covered.

Most emergency calls run $100–$500 total, with emergency rates averaging around $170 per hour in 2026. Holidays and overnight calls sit at the top of that range.
Usually not, but it's urgent. If you can contain it in a bucket and shut off a local valve, it can wait for normal-hours pricing. If it's inside a wall or ceiling, treat it as an emergency — the damage compounds fast.
Policies commonly cover sudden and accidental water damage and generally exclude long-term seepage and maintenance failures, but coverage varies by policy and state. Read your own declarations page and call your carrier — do not rely on what a contractor tells you is covered.
If the leak involves the water heater or you're shutting off the whole house, yes — cut power or gas to the unit. An electric element that fires in an empty tank can be destroyed in minutes.
